In Anthem, little harmless creatures called Klauninchen are running around. BioWare is giving more and more hints that there is more to these cute beings than meets the eye. What is behind them?
What are Klauninchen? These animals are a crazy mix of squirrel, fox, lizard, and moth. They are about the size of dogs and are suspected of stealing and hoarding things, but are otherwise harmless. At least that is the impression.
Klauninchen unleash a big debate among players, which quickly made them fan favorites:
- some are slaughtering the creatures and do not trust them
- others find Klauninchen cute and want to protect them
What suggests that Klauninchen play a bigger role:
- BioWare repeatedly hints that Klauninchen are dangerous and that one should leave them in peace
- Klauninchen reportedly have hidden levels according to employees
- BioWare had a counter running in the demo for how many Klauninchen were killed
In a letter to fans, the Head of Live Service, Chad Robertson, informed the community that over 2 million Klauninchen were killed in the VIP demo of Anthem. He referred to these players as monsters. In other letters, Robertson also mentioned that one should be nice to Klauninchen.
Other BioWare employees also imply that slaughtering the creatures could have consequences. The employee BioWareBen revealed after the open demo that Klauninchen even have a secret level. This is a clear indication that Klauninchen can be found in various strengths.

What role could Klauninchen play?
The clues are pretty clear that BioWare is planning something with the Klauninchen. The only question is, what.
A big boss enemy? It is conceivable that there is a gigantic Klauninchen that appears as a boss enemy. The Klauninchen could sit in a stronghold at the end of a Klauninchen den. Strongholds are mini-raids.
This boss would, of course, take revenge on the players who killed his brothers and sisters. Strongholds will be part of the endgame content of Anthem. So it could be quite a chunk of Klauninchen.
An event around Klauninchen? It is exciting that BioWare allowed a counter for Klauninchen kills to run in the demo. It is also important that BioWare revealed the kill count to the players.
This could indicate that an event is planned here, once players have killed a certain number of Klauninchen. It is possible that Klauninchen will go berserk on the map of Anthem as soon as the event is triggered. It would also fit that they have hidden levels. They could swarm the players in masses.
Great significance in the story? BioWare is known for writing stories for its games that continually surprise. In Mass Effect, for example, there are bug-like beings called “Keepers” that maintain the space station Citadel like janitors. They remain unimportant for the players for a long time and ignore them until they suddenly gain great importance for the story.
Typically for BioWare, players might expect a surprise in the story with the Klauninchen. Maybe Klauninchen actually belong to the ancient technologies left behind by the god-like Shapers?
This is the MeinMMO community’s stance on Klauninchen
We asked you how you feel about Klauninchen. The MeinMMO community is divided in the debate about the creatures. A total of 1,634 readers voted at the time of evaluation (February 5, 6:00 PM).
The result:
- 53% say: “I want to save Klauninchen!”
- 47% say: “I want to kill Klauninchen!”
Most of you side with the Klauninchen. What this will mean for the future of Anthem, we will have to wait and see.
